Ireland is home to some of the top academic courses in the world, offering a wide range of opportunities for students looking to further their education. From arts and humanities to business and technology, there is a course to suit every interest and career goal. Here are some of the top academic courses to pursue in Ireland.

1. Medicine: Ireland is known for its world-class medical education, with prestigious universities offering cutting-edge programs in medicine and healthcare. Studying medicine in Ireland provides students with the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in state-of-the-art hospitals and clinics, preparing them for a successful career in the healthcare field.

2. Engineering: Ireland is at the forefront of technological innovation, making it an ideal destination for students interested in pursuing a career in engineering. From civil and mechanical engineering to computer and electrical engineering, there are a variety of programs available to suit every interest and skill set.

3. Business: Ireland has a thriving business sector, making it an attractive destination for students looking to pursue a career in business and management. With top-ranked business schools offering programs in areas such as finance, marketing, and entrepreneurship, students have the opportunity to gain valuable skills and knowledge to succeed in the competitive business world.

4. Law: Ireland has a rich legal history and offers top-notch law programs for students interested in pursuing a career in the legal field. From international law to human rights law, students have the opportunity to study under esteemed professors and gain real-world experience through internships and clinics.

5. Arts and Humanities: Ireland is known for its vibrant cultural scene, making it a great destination for students interested in studying arts and humanities. From literature and history to music and theater, there are a variety of programs available to help students explore their passion and develop their creative talents.

Overall, Ireland offers a diverse range of academic courses for students looking to further their education. With top-ranked universities and prestigious programs in a variety of fields, Ireland is an ideal destination for students seeking a high-quality education and a rewarding career.
